摘 要
语音识别主要是让机器听懂人说的话,即在各种情况下,准确地识别出语音的内容,从而根据其信息执行人的各种意图。语音识别技术既是国际竞争的一项重要技术,也是每一个国家经济发展不可缺少的重要技术支撑。本文基于语音信号产生的数学模型,从时域、频域出发对语音信号进行分析,论述了语音识别的基本理论。在此基础上讨论了语音识别的五种算法:动态时间伸缩算法(Dynamic Time Warping,DTW)、基于规则的人工智能方法、人工神经网络(Artificial Neural Network,ANN)方法、隐马尔可夫(Hidden Markov Model,HMM)方法、HMM和ANN的混合模型。重点是从理论上研究隐马尔可夫(HMM)模型算法,对经典的HMM模型算法进行改进。
语音识别算法有多种实现方案,本文采取的方法是利用Matlab强大的数学运算能力,实现孤立语音信号的识别。Matlab 是一款功能强大的数学软件,它附带大量的信号处理工具箱为信号分析研究,特别是文中主要探讨的声波分析研究带来极大便利。本文应用隐马尔科夫模型(HMM) 为识别算法,采用MFCC(MEL频率倒谱系数)为主要语音特征参数,建立了一个汉语数字语音识别系统,其中包括语音信号的预处理、特征参数的提取、识别模板的训练、识别匹配算法;同时,提出利用Matlab图形用户界面开发环境设计语音识别系统界面,设计简单,使用方
您可能关注的文档
- 机用虎钳三维造型与工艺制作大学生毕业论文.doc
- 基金业绩和规模的相关性及其影响机理研究大学生毕业论文.doc
- 基于“智慧城市”中移动互联网技术的发展研究大学生毕业论文.doc
- 基于3g的图像传输技术研究大学生毕业论文.doc
- 基于3s理论技术的实时交通信息系统研究大学生毕业论文.doc
- 基于51单片机的led点阵显示屏系统的设计与实现课程设计大学生毕业论文.doc
- 基于51单片机的usb键盘设计与实现大学生毕业论文.doc
- 基于51单片机的日历时钟显示系统设计大学生毕业论文.doc
- 基于51单片机的温湿度检测控制系统大学生毕业论文.doc
- 基于51单片机的液晶显示屏控制系统设计大学生毕业论文.doc
原创力文档

文档评论(0)